  • Roshaante Andersen was born intersex.
    Intersex is a general term used for a variety of conditions in which a person is born with a reproductive or sexual anatomy that doesn't seem to fit the typical definitions of female or male.
    Roshaante was born with a vagina and internal testicles. He did not find out he was intersex until he was 11 years old.
    In this interview he takes us through growing up as intersex, why he chose to live as a man, and what sex feels like with both genders.
